Hello Nubians,

Continuing my Monday Muse segment, I'd like to feature one of my favorites... Italian bombshell Sophia Loren.

I absolutely LOVE what Sophia Loren stood for. She embraced everything life through her way. She had humble beginnings, born in the slums of Naples and somehow ended up becoming a sex symbol worldwide and even won an an Oscar in 1960 for her role in Two Women. Genius right?

She's one of those people that had magic in her eyes... I guess you could say she "smized"? (way before you Tyra). I also admire how she always encouraged woman to indulge more in self discovery and love one self everyday.

My Favorite Sophia Loren Quotes

  • There is a fountain of youth: it is your mind, your talents, the creativity you bring to your life and the lives of people you love. When you learn to tap this source, you will truly have defeated age.
  • You have to enjoy life. Always be surrounded by people that you like, people who have a nice conversation. There are so many positive things to think about.
  • Spaghetti can be eaten most successfully if you inhale it like a vacuum cleaner. 
  • I think the quality of sexiness comes from within. It is something that is in you or it isn't and it really doesn't have much to do with breasts or thighs or the pout of your lips.
  • Sex appeal is fifty percent what you've got and fifty percent what people think you've got.
  • A woman's dress should be like a barbed-wire fence: serving its purpose without obstructing the view.


An absolutely ravishing, accomplished, fearless lady to have as a muse any given day of the week.

Yesterday I was watching the Golden Globes for a bit and I noticed the ever so radiant Meryl Streep. This woman has a shining light around her doesn't she? Always glowing.

Many say she's one of the greatest film actors of all time. I myself have enjoyed all the films I've seen her in and think she's a superb actress, an icon really. However, acting isn't the reason I've chosen her as my muse today.




















Some Of My Favorite Things About Meryl Streep. 


  • Meryl Streep was suppose to go to Law School but her alarm didn't go off in time. She took it as a sign and instead went to Yale for Drama following her intuitions (who does that? how brave and daring). 
  • She is absolutely hilarious! Even though she did most of her comedies early in her career, her humor always shines through interviews and award shows... plus she can take a joke.   
  • She's done so many different accent in her movies British, Australian, New Yorker (Bronx), Italian AND I thought they were all good!
  • She played Miranda Priestly (Anna Wintour) in The Devil Wears Prada for God sake! Made me love her so much more at the time, she absolutely conquered that role. 
  • She is highly known for good work ethic. 
  • Never afraid to open her mouth and say what she has to say. 
  • Producer Dino DeLaurentis said she was "too ugly" for the damsel role in King Kong. I believe her called her "a pig" Didn't phase her. (Obviously he had poor vision and personally disgust me for speaking about an ambitious woman in that manner.)
  • Sesame Street named a character after her "Meryl Sheep" (how awesome is that?!)
  • Oh and lets not forget that countless amounts of awards she has. Well deserved. (Academy Award, Tony, Emmy, Golden Globe and More. 


These are some of my favorite facts about Meryl Streep. She by definition has everything I admire in a woman. She is effortlessly beautiful, kind, funny, and ambitious. A women who will stop at nothing to be where she knows she belongs.
